Ingredients You’ll Need

To create your own Festive Christmas Cranberry Roll Ups, gather these simple ingredients:

  • 1 cup cranberry sauce
  • 1 package cream cheese, softened
  • 1 flour tortilla
  • 1/2 cup chopped pecans (optional)
  • 1 tablespoon honey (optional)
  • Fresh herbs for garnish (optional)

Using fresh dried cranberries can give this a unique zing, making it a personal touch. I love adding a smattering of herbs, which brightens up the palette of flavors beautifully.

Step-by-Step Directions

  1. In a bowl, mix the softened cream cheese and cranberry sauce together until smooth.
  2. Spread the mixture evenly over the tortilla, reaching all the edges.
  3. If using, sprinkle chopped pecans on top of the mixture for a delightful crunch.
  4. Drizzle honey over the pecans for added sweetness if desired.
  5. Roll the tortilla tightly and slice into pinwheels or serve whole, however you prefer.
  6. Garnish with fresh herbs if desired and serve immediately.

Quick Tips from My Kitchen

Here are a few tips I’ve drawn on while making these roll-ups over the years:

  1. Use flavored cream cheese: Different variations like herb or garlic cream cheese can heighten the flavor dramatically.
  2. Adjust the sweetness to taste: If you prefer it sweeter, increase the honey or even add a little maple syrup.
  3. Experiment with tortillas: Whole wheat or spinach tortillas can add a lovely touch and create a more nutritious option.
  4. Chill the mixture: Letting the cream cheese and cranberry mixture sit for a short time lets the flavors meld beautifully.
  5. Add some zest: A sprinkle of orange or lemon zest adds a fresh brightness that enhances the dish.

FAQs About Festive Christmas Cranberry Roll Ups

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Yes. I often prep it in the morning before the girls wake up and finish it right before dinner. It keeps the flavor fresh and saves time later.

Is this dish suitable for a gluten-free diet?
Absolutely! Simply use gluten-free tortillas to make this a cozy option for everyone.

Can I freeze these roll-ups?
While I suggest enjoying them fresh, you can freeze them before slicing. Just ensure they are tightly wrapped and use them within a month for the best quality.

What should I serve with them?
These roll-ups are fabulous paired with a fresh green salad or as finger food at a party. They can brighten up a brunch spread too.

How do I keep them from getting soggy?
If you plan to make them ahead of time, consider storing the cream cheese filling separately and spreading it onto the tortillas just before serving.
